Blog Archive Synapse email updates Enter first name required Enter email required Enter postcode required see newsletter archive Back to all Share Even a Brain Injury couldn't keep this talented jockey down A big congratulations goes out to yesterday's Melbourne Cup winning jockey Michelle Payne. By now you will probably have heard that Michelle is the first ever female jockey to take home the cup. What you may not know is that she has experienced what it's like to live with a Brain Injury first hand. In March 2004 she had a serious fall during a race at Sandown Racecourse in Melbourne. The fall resulted in a fractured skull, as well as bruising to her brain. Michelle spent 15 months in rehabilitation after her Brain Injury before returning to the sport she loves, despite the fact that her father and siblings had been keen for her to retire.
